Requirements to Drive:
- Meet the minimum age to drive in your city.
- Have at least one year of licensed driving experience in the US (three years if you are under 25 years old).
- Use an eligible 4-door vehicle.
- You consent to driver screening and background check.
- You have an iPhone or Android smartphone.
- Vehicle Requirements vary by region; we'll show you what is needed.

Additional Documents to Drive:
- A valid US Driver's license.
- Proof of residency in your city, state, or province.
- Proof of vehicle insurance if you plan to drive your own vehicle.
*Depending on your city or state, additional documentation or information may be required. Our support team is available 24/7 to help answer any questions you may have about registration.
